Go read Ed Krol's Internet column in Network World, Nov 8. 1993.
I'll let him make the case for it, but his conclusion is "... we need
to get rid of the restrictions on use. To do that, we need to get
the governmen tout of the networking business and allow businesses
that are not subject to government accounting rules to provide those
services".
